Volleyball Preview: Heritage Christian Warriors vs. Whittier Christian Heralds
Heritage Christian is 2-8 against Whittier Christian since September of 2018 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Monday. The Heritage Christian Warriors are taking a road trip to challenge the Whittier Christian Heralds at 5:15 p.m.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.
Heritage Christian came up short against Valley Christian on Thursday, falling 3-0. The Warriors have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
The final score came out to 25-21, 25-16, 25-21.
Meanwhile, Whittier Christian came up short against Maranatha on Tuesday and fell 3-1.
While Whittier Christian ultimately came up short, they really made Maranatha work, particularly in the first set. The match finished with set scores of 28-26, 22-25, 25-19, 25-18.
Heritage Christian's defeat dropped their record down to 16-9. As for Whittier Christian, they have traveled a rocky road recently having lost 16 of their last 18 contests, which put a noticeable dent in their 5-24 record this season.
Everything went Heritage Christian's way against Whittier Christian in their previous meeting back in September, as Heritage Christian made off with a 3-0 win. The rematch might be a little tougher for Heritage Christian since the team won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
